Service Accounts — Driftline SDK Parity. The Kestrel (Go) and Marlin (Python) SDKs now expose identical service-account token flows as of release 4.2. Remaining gap: Marlin lacks automatic token refresh on 401; targeted for 4.3. Parity tests run nightly against the Harborgate staging tenant. The parity suite authenticates using the key below.

app token of yajeg-kawef = kto11_7En3XSX8xQw

## Deployment

Quick note for plugin authors: Swivelbay enforces per-tenant rate quotas at the gateway, so your plugin shares a budget with everything else running in that tenant. If you hammer the API, everyone in the tenant gets throttled, and they will find you. Quotas refill per minute and burst a little above the cap. The defaults a fresh tenant deploys with are as follows.

config for kafof-bawef:
holath:
  log_level: debug
  metrics_host: metrics.holath.qorvelsys.internal
  pin: 2191
  pool_size: 32

Release checklist — TileVault cache layer (Orrin Maps 7.1). Support: before confirming a customer is on the patched build, verify that cold-start tile fetches fall back to origin correctly and that the eviction counter resets after warmup. Customers on mixed-version clusters may see brief stale-tile warnings; these are expected for up to ten minutes post-upgrade. When opening an escalation with the cache team, always include the customer's region, cluster size, and the build token shown below.

build token for kagaf-hahof: htk14_9d3d4d26d7d8de

// AUTOCOMPLETE_DEBOUNCE_MS
//
// Controls how long the Marrowgate address widget waits after the last
// keystroke before querying the suggestion service. Do not lower this
// below 150ms: the upstream Tolby geocoder rate-limits aggressively and
// will drop the whole session, not just the request. If you change this,
// also update the matching constant in the mobile shell, or the two
// clients will drift. Verified against the build whose token appears on
// the next line.

build token for tawip-yageg: htk9_92ac43d42